Re[7]: Бинарная совместимость?
Добрый день.
V> Безусловно, отличается.
V> Речь шла о том, что автор исходного вопроса не вполне корректно его поставил.
V> К чему усложнять себе жизнь, если в портах есть и staroffice, и openoffice,
и
V> все что нужно для нормальной жизни.
V> Набрал одну команду - и ты в шоколаде.
IMHO весьма спорно.
V> У меня 1.0.3, есть кто-нибудь в этом листе, у кого 1.1.0 из портов? Апгрейдиться,
V> собственно говоря, стоит?
Конечно, стоит. Запускается и работает он заметно быстрее. Преимуществ
достаточно много. Сейчас вышла версия 1.1.1, она уже есть и в портах.
V> Меня напрягают в основном две вещи - в некоторых вордовых документах опенофис
V> отдельно взятые абзацы выделяет красным цветом и зачеркивает - не вполне ясно,
V> откуда эта ботва берется. Логики и закономерности проследить не удалось.
Думаю сущность проблемы состоит, по-видимому, в том, что там явно не
указан язык. Попробуйте явно указать русский для абзаца. Можете
прислать пример мне лично: скажу точнее.
V> Второе, что анноит - полная корявость при работе с документами Excel/95
V> Кириллица не отображается никак, структура документа перековеркана. Что напрягает,
V> поскольку большинство автоматических систем выписки счетов создают документы
V> именно в формате Excel/95 - для пущей совместимости.
V> Открываю документ в нативном MS Excel'е, сохраняю в новом формате, переношу
обратно
V> - все работает отлично.
Сущность проблемы состоит в том, что OOo юникодовый, а в экселе 95 не
проставляется локаль. Для решения этой проблемы существуют макросы
перекодирования.
Существует достаточно продвинутая библиотека CyrillicTools, в которой
существует средства для борьбы с этим и еще много полезных вещей.
Взять ее можно на http://openoffice.vspu.ac.ru/cyrtools1.1.uno.zip или
http://docs.openoffice.ru/~doc/ooextras/cyrtools1.1.uno.zip
На http://openoffice.vspu.ac.ru/ или внутри пакета есть инструкция, в
которой все возможности расписаны достаточно подробно.
Правда инструкции по ее установке на BSD не подойдут: она сделана в
формате uno-package, а под BSD утилита установки pkgchk не может
отработать. Об этом я писал ранее.
Нужно будет установить и запускать библиотеку руками, причем
функциональность будет заметно хуже, чем под Linux или Win, где
есть меню, диалоги для многих функций, сохранение параметров.
Работать будет половина всего этого арсенала.
При установке Linux-версии OOo или StarOffice на BSD все идет как по маслу.
В сборках OOo от AltLinux сейчас используется предок одного компонента
библиотеки- RecodeCyr. Могу выслать если нужен.
Кстати, по вопросам работы в OOo много полезного можно узнать в
рассылке openoffice.ru: http://www.openoffice.ru/mailman/listinfo/oo-discuss
V> Догоняться до 1.1.0 стоит? Или я опять увижу те же яйца?
С уважением,
Владимир <vb***@a*****.ru>
-*Информационный канал Subscribe.Ru
Написать в лист: mailto:comp.soft.bsd.all-list@subscribe.ru
Отписаться: mailto:comp.soft.bsd.all--unsub@subscribe.ru
http://subscribe.ru/ mailto:ask@subscribe.ru